Gaétan Malette for Representative



Gaétan Malette is a Canadian politician, business leader, and community advocate who has made a significant impact in Ontario’s political landscape. A dedicated member of the Conservative Party of Canada, Malette was elected as the Member of Parliament for Kapuskasing—Timmins—Mushkegowuk in the 2025 Canadian federal election, succeeding longtime NDP MP Charlie Angus. His journey to public office was shaped by decades of experience in forestry, economic development, and Indigenous partnerships.

Born and raised in Northern Ontario, Malette developed a deep connection to the region’s industries and communities. His early years were marked by a passion for sustainable resource management, leading him to pursue a career in forestry. Over the course of 45 years, he worked extensively in forestry, agriculture, and mining, gaining firsthand knowledge of the challenges and opportunities facing northern businesses. His expertise in economic development positioned him as a respected figure in Ontario’s resource-based industries.

Malette’s leadership extended beyond business, as he actively engaged in community service and governance. He worked closely with First Nations communities across Canada, fostering partnerships that supported economic growth and self-sufficiency. His commitment to Indigenous collaboration reinforced his reputation as a leader who prioritizes inclusivity and long-term development.

In addition to his work in economic development, Malette served on several local boards, including the Timmins District Hospital and the police services board. His involvement in these organizations allowed him to contribute to public safety, healthcare improvements, and community well-being. His ability to bridge business expertise with public service made him a strong advocate for northern Ontario’s interests.

Malette’s transition into federal politics was driven by his desire to bring a strong, business-focused voice to Ottawa. His campaign emphasized economic growth, infrastructure investment, and reducing regulatory burdens for industries in Northern Ontario.
